I lived at Rivercrest for 2 years and constantly had problems. The first year I lived there management had a complete turnover about every 6-8 weeks.

They constantly sent notices saying that rent was overdue and I was being evicted. Ofcourse, the notices were on practically every door.

It was amazing if there were less then 2 car break ins a week, and there were usually more.

A guy in one of my classes also lived there was attacked by a guy with a lead pipe. Totally serious. Fortunately he's a tenacious guy and managed to get the pipe away from him, but he still had to go to the hospital and get stitches.

We also had a drug dealer living across the street. He actually just grew and made stuff, but about every three months a new set of guys would move in and take over the operation.

I never had the mold problem in the bathroom, but several friends that lived there did and it was disgusting.

I never really had a need to call maintenance, but they seemed to do okay on getting stuff fixed the few times I did call them. I think it was because they guy liked my roommate though.

I moved out before the construction started, but my boyfriend still lived there until Dec '04 and the same comments as all the other reviews go. Start early, are loud, takes forever.

One of his neighbors actually had to move out, basically overnight, because she was not given any notice that the patios were being made smaller. She was doing foster care and had to have a certain size yard. Because of the decrease in the patio with no notice she had to move out asap.

I also had a really hard time getting my deposit back. Not because the apartment wasn't clean, but because they screwed up in the computer. "Fortunately" I had enough problems with them early on I kept all of my records so I could prove what I paid to them to get my money back. It took forever though.

Live somewhere else, basically anywhere is better.
